Brand Name Hotels in Banff

  • The Best of NileGuide
  • There aren't a lot of brand-name hotels in Banff, at least not common chain-brands like Holiday Inn. But, there are a lot of hotels, many of them operated by the Banff Lodging Company, which has high standards of service and quality. Banff hotels offer more than just a clean room. They provide a quaint, mountain experience, great views, and friendly staff.

    The Fairmont Banff Springs is Alberta's pre-eminent four seasons resort. It is pricey, but it is also a once-in-a-lifetime experience for many. The grounds are beautiful. Hiking around the hotel is plentiful. The river runs nearby. And, there are wild animals to be seen, year-round. The Banff Springs is a historic hotel for Canada, and it truly made Banff into the tourist destination that it currently is.

    The Delta Banff Royal Canadian Lodge is one of Banff's 4 star hotels, but it is near the downtown area, unlike the Banff Springs and Rimrock. This hotel is close to Banff Ave., where most of Banff's shops, restaurants, and pubs are located.

    The Banff Lodging Company owns the Fox and Caribou, among several others in Banff. These hotels have a reputation for being cozy and comfortable. They all look perfect from the outside, and inside they are well-maintained and clean. Banff Lodging Company hotels are good value for the money.
